Wholesale
- ‘Settings’ tab > Global configuration > Signup and verification — new setting ‘Require utility bill or business confirmation’
- If turned on, customers will need to provide a utility bill (for personal accounts) or business documents (for business accounts), even after their identity has been successfully verified via Stripe
- New customer verification statuses:
- Utility bill / business registration required — this means that the customer has passed Stripe’s automated verification and now only needs to upload the last documents
- Utility bill / business registration submitted — this means that the customer has provided the documents and they need to be checked by the support team
